I've got a Sentry el-cheapo 14 gun safe that I need to secure to the concrete slab in my garage (via the holes in the bottom), anyone know how to do this?
I assume I need to drill holes into the concrete but I'm unsure how to secure the bolts into the concrete. Anyone have any experience in this? How are the threads created? Tips? Please? Can ya a guy out?

Go to any hardware store and get anchor bolt inserts.

You drill the hole in the floor with a concrete drill bit( hammer drill helps too)

drop in the insert.

Place safe.

Then put in the bolts that come with the inserts.

As you thread the bolts in the insert spreads out at the bottom to act as an anchor ( hence the name anchor bolt)

Don't worry about having to thread the concrete -- that won't work.

But your local hardware store should have several different styles of bolts that are specifically designed to anchor in concrete.  The different styles are rated for different load levels.

Think carefully about where you'll be placing the bolts; once they're locked into the concrete, the only way to remove them is to either chip away the concrete or to cut them off flush with something like a Dremel tool.

I spent four years on the road drilling holes in concrete floors to mount equipment, including in earthquake zones like California. As Sweep said, rent a quality hammerdrill since they cost $400-500 for a good one, and you'll rarely use the hammer function. Black and Decker makes a good one, and it uses standard SAE sized bits, as opposed to Hilti which uses proprietary metric bits.

Hilti also makes excellent anchors, but they'd probably be overkill in your situation. Redheads, as osprey21 mentioned, are good quality concrete anchors. Before you start putting holes in your floor, you need to find out if you're on a post-tension slab floor. The last thing you want to do is cut a cable and destroy your slab. Different anchors require different depth holes. If you only have to drill a 2" deep hole, you should be okay even on a post-tension slab, but your mileage may vary.

One more suggestion.  If you use the suggestions above the bolts will be very secure, however the floor of the safe will be only marginal.  Place a large diameter flat washer between the floor of the safe and the bolt head.  The will increase surface area around the bolt head and make the bolt head less likely to pull through the safe floor if a pry bar or jack is used to move the safe.  At about 15 cents each cheap insurance.

Another tip: Carefully mark the locations you're going to drill the holes with a centerpunch, and be very steady and sure that you don't let the bit "walk" while you're drilling. It's no fun to have to move the whole thing over and redrill two holes because you can't get the thing to line up.

If you REALLY want to get medieval, bolt the safe to the floor, about 8" out from the wall.  Plug the unused bolt holes.  Surround the safe with plywood forms, standing the sides out about 6", and making the height about 6" taller than the safe.  Use a silicone sealer to hold the front plywood panel flush with the door of the safe.

Construct a cage with rebar that surrounds the safe, leaving the front open.  You can go cheap and use chain-link fence cut to size, or omit it altogether.

Get about 15 bags of Sakrete concrete mix, a large plastic kiddie pool, some 5 gallon plastic pails, gloves and a case of beer.  Friends would be helpful at this point.

Mix the concrete and use pails to fill the form from the top.  Level with a trowel when you reach the top of the form.

Suggested modifications:

1. Drill two small holes in the top of the safe to accomodate fittings and some 1/4" copper tubing.  Run the tubing straig out the top, about 4" above the anticipated concrete level. Drill a small hole in the bottom side of the safe and thread a heavy duty extension cord through. Seal hole with silicone.  This will allow some small amount of air circulation and you can run a goldenrod to eliminate moisture.

2. Affix 2 large hardened eyebolts at the sides of the safe before you pour.  Use them to attach a "lock bar" across the front for extra protection.  Use two sets, top and bottom.
